There's this roleplaying game called Mutants and Masterminds; it's basically D&D with superheroes. Anyway, they have a campaign setting called Freedom City, more or less a Marvel/ DC amalgam (though they're expanding past homage/ pastiche characters into more original fare with 3e's upcoming spin-off setting, Emerald City, which is kinda like Gotham to FC's Metropolis). Anyhoo, they've got a few fembots running around, so I thought I'd share.

Also, as far as regular male cyborgs go, I forgot to mention the name Trax Videozap. Space Warrior Trax Videozap wears a bodysuit that is fitted with many electronic/cybernetic implants, and in place of two eyes, he sees through a small video screen, almost like Cyclops and Mandora. Trax is the main protagonist (hero) of a gamebook-story entitled MAZEWARPS, which was written by a guy named Vladimir Koziakin. (Is anyone familiar with Mr. Koziakin or any of his books?) Koziakin has created many other maze books as well, such as the LABYRINTHON gamebook-story series - which features elements of Disney's TRON franchise - and other publications like SPACE MAZES, HORROR MAZES, MONSTER MAZES, SHARK MAZES, etc. (Just Google Vladimir Koziakin, MAZEWARPS and/or LABYRINTHON.) As a book, Koziakin's MAZEWARPS features approximately twenty-four mazes that must each be completed within a certain amount of time. The story is about Trax Videozap having to battle Dicto/Galaxis, an evil Dark Lord who is best described as a demonically powerful alien mutant with teleportation capabilities and whose empire is guarded by about two dozen mazewarps, or dark labyrinths that each hold its own type of killer obstacles. At the center of this brief contest between Good and Evil is the beautiful Venus 11-B, a young woman who has the access codes to and who is a frequent user of a vast nebula of energy that can send any interstellar vessel anywhere in the Universe within a short time frame, most likely by utilizing what scientists now call wormholes that exist in the space-time continuum. All each starship needs is its own personal access code to activate and utilize this powerful Gateway, and whoever has these codes pretty much has control of the Universe's major space routes, which explains why this diabolical and power-hungry Dicto/Galaxis hijacked Venus's ship, kidnapped her, imprisoned her and interrogated her about the codes for this vast gateway. Anyway, your total time (in seconds) in all of the mazes at the end determines whether or not you reach this Dark Lord's empire in time before he is able to get the codes from Venus.
